Re: Royal Roads Eagles, Colwood, BC - 2019-2022 Seasons
I was at Esquimalt Lagoon on Thurs. Apr. 14th and saw one of the adult eagles circle overhead, making all the other ducks and birds take flight. It swooped down, chased and caught a duck, then flew to a tree at the other end of the bridge. I lost track of it but another observer said she saw it land with the duck. I did manage to capture a photo of it in flight before it grabbed the duck.
The trees where the eagle landed with the duck. Unfortunately I wasn't able to pinpoint just where the eagle was perched but the eagles perch in these trees quite often.

Re: Royal Roads Eagles, Colwood, BC - 2019-2022 Seasons
Yesterday afternoon my birding partner and I were excited to be in attendance when some very special people retrieved the lone eaglet in the Royal Roads nest to perform some tests and band the eaglet. Miles Lamont, who has worked with David Hancock for many years, and John, a fellow from the Ministry, took blood samples and recorded measurements and banded the eaglet, after the tree climber retrieved the eaglet from the nest and sent it down in a bag. The tree climber remained at the nest until the eaglet was sent up, to be put back into the nest. The eaglet was fitted with a hood which kept it calm while the guys were collecting the samples and recording the measurements. The hood was removed when they had finished and the eaglet became very feisty, trying to bite the guys. When the eaglet was placed on the ground it tried to escape and Miles had to pull it out from under the truck. This is a good indication that the eaglet will be able to fend for itself after it fledges.
